#3b460c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3b460c is composed of 23.1% red, 27.5%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.9% yellow and 72.5% black. It has a hue angle of 71.4 degrees, a saturation of 70.7% and a lightness of 16.1%. #3b460c color hex could be obtained by blending #768c18 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#3b460c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#3b460c has RGB values of R:59, G:70,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0.16, M:0, Y:0.83,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 3884556.
